[0.7.2] - 2020-10-09
Release Notes
We’ve added a list of all papers using (and citing) TeNPy, see Papers using TeNPy. Feel free to include your own works!
And a slight simplicifation, which might affect your code:
using the MultiCouplingModel is no longer necessary, just use the tenpy.models.model.CouplingModel directly.
Changelog
Backwards incompatible changes
Deprecated the
tenpy.models.model.MultiCouplingModel. The functionality is fully merged into theCouplingModel, no need to subclass the MultiCouplingModel anymore.The
Kagomelattice did not include all next_next_nearest_neighbors. (It had only the ones across the hexagon, missing those maiking up a bow-tie.)Combined arguments onsite_terms and coupling_terms of
tenpy.networks.mpo.MPOGraph.from_terms()into a single argument terms.
Added
Allow to include jupyter notebooks into the documentation; collect example notebooks in [TeNPyNotebooks].
term_correlation_function_right()andterm_correlation_function_left()for correlation functions with more than one operator on each end.tenpy.networks.terms.ExponentiallyDecayingTermsfor constructing MPOs with exponential decay, andtenpy.networks.model.CouplingModel.add_exponentially_decaying_coupling()for using it. This closes issue #78.
Fixed
The
IrregularLatticeused the'default'order of the regular lattice instead of whatever the order of the regular lattice was.charge_variance()did not work for more than 1 charge.
